Restrict the air flow to get the bubble size you want. Then adjust the foam height to where you want by restricting the output. Once you get it perfect do not touch anything as its a PITA to find that sweet spot again... if for some reason your skimmer starts acting up it probably means you just fed the tank some oily food, something died, something spawned, or it just needs to be cleaned. Heres a little trick: run a decent amount of fresh water through your air intake weekly (I use a full 1 gallon bucket) to dissolve any dried on salt that forms inside.
